I’ve been using a vegetable spiralizer for awhile now to make vegetable noodles.  When I switched over to a no grain diet I needed something to put my pesto and home made meat sauce on!  I started by using zucchini only as it is the easiest one to use (leave the skin on for the healthy green part, but you can peel to make it look more like real noodles!) I have now branched out into carrots, sweet potato and daikon radish.  I have yet to try parsnips, turnips, cucumber, broccoli stems, apples and squash!  One of my favorite recipes using daikon radish is pad thai.  A great cookbook which I got recently is here and I can’t wait to try out some new recipes!

Some other great ideas:

  • cold noodle salad made with carrot noodles
  • broccoli slaw
  • sweet potato curly fries!
  • apple dessert made with apple spirals
  • pretty spiralized beets on top of a salad or roasted (wash spiralizer right away or will stain)
